    Sadly, I can't post with my old iPhone. But there are pics in alblum. I have 1 very large plant in a pot inside an octagon tank. So around bottom is where food goes and cannot hide anywhere, easy for me to track that she ate 7 small crix in 2 days. She was raised at the store at 50% humidity and was burrowed all the time. She seems to stay at bottom so i added a kids tea cup for a hide near the plant, and theres a log hide at bottom also. So my humidity is 70%, so I'm concerned cuz I read somewhere little ones are prone to fungal infections, so should I drop humidity a bit? and store had her at room temp, I have 80, but her log is by side heatmat, so it's round 85 down there.

    Humidity is fine, 70 should be the target for a white's, temp is fine as well. I would worry more about fungal issues at 90% or more.
